What Are the Average 18 wheeler accident attorney Wheeler Settlements?
One of the most frequent questions that those who have been involved in truck accidents is "What is the typical settlements for 18-wheelers?" The amount you receive as settlement is contingent on a variety of factors. This includes the severity of your injuries as well as the severity of your injuries. What to Expect from the Settlement There are a myriad of factors that can impact the value of a truck crash settlement. One of them is the severity and duration of your injuries, as well as your lost wages. Furthermore, your attorney might take into account future medical costs in the event that you require ongoing medical treatment because of your accident. This is typically based upon expert testimony from doctors or other health care experts. In addition, your lawyer will also look at the cost of repairing or replace any property damaged by the crash. In general the case of 18-wheeler accidents, settlements are much higher than those for auto accidents of a normal nature. This is due to the fact that truck accidents often cause more serious injuries than regular car accidents. It is not uncommon for victims of truck accidents to suffer damages in the hundreds of thousands or even millions, of dollars. You'll also be entitled to compensation for damages that are not economic in addition to your economic losses. These are less measurable losses but are equally important to your overall recovery. For instance the non-economic costs could include your pain and suffering, loss of enjoyment of life, 18 wheeler accident attorney or even disfigurement. Your lawyer will determine all your losses to make sure you get the compensation you are due. This could take a while especially if multiple parties are responsible for the accident. However, a skilled New York truck accident attorney can help you settle your claim quickly and fairly. The Benefits of Your Case A variety of factors can affect the value of your 18 wheeler accident-wheeler accident case. Two of them are fault and damages. Fault is important because it determines how much you are entitled to in compensation. In Texas the law states that you can only recover damages if the other party was at least 50 percent responsible for the collision. Your attorney can make use of evidence to prove that you were not as at fault as the other party. This could increase the settlement amount substantially. The severity of your losses or injuries can affect the amount you can expect to receive. The injuries sustained in a collision with an 18-wheeler could be more severe than injuries suffered in a car accident. This is because trucks weigh more than 80,000 pounds, which multiplied by the speed of travel generates far more force than a passenger vehicle can handle. The most serious injuries suffered in an accident involving a large truck could lead to settlements of a million dollars or more. In addition to the medical costs of treating your injuries, you can also seek compensation for the effects the crash has affected your life quality. This includes discomfort and pain and loss of enjoyment life, and loss of companionship. These non-economic damages are typically difficult to quantify, but our lawyers can help you prepare and present the best evidence possible of the financial impact. The Time It Takes to Receive a Settlement It can take a longer time for a personal injury case to be settled following an accident with an 18-wheeler as a result of the degree and frequency of injuries. Your attorney will work with medical experts to determine the complete extent of your injuries, including future and ongoing medical expenses as well as loss of wages. The settlement will also cover economic damages that are difficult to quantify. After a settlement has been made your lawyer will then prepare release forms for you to sign. When you sign them the insurance company processes the case and sends you the check in the amount you agreed to. This process can take weeks or even a whole month depending on the situation. A major factor in determining how long it takes to get your settlement is the proportion of fault assigned to each of the parties involved in the crash. In cases where there was more than one person responsible, it could be necessary to negotiate who's responsible for the injuries. Your experienced attorney will be able to guide you through these negotiations and help you find an equitable settlement. If the insurance company is unwilling to negotiate with you, your attorney will be ready to file a lawsuit in order to receive a larger monetary settlement.
